Just installed another Covid special over the weekend and having a great time flying.

This is the Carenado Saab 340 commuter turboprop in a Rex livery, a plane and company I've flown on and with many a times to regional areas of Australia.

And during those times, I've watched a pilot doing his walk around reject a tire, then get a mechanic to jackup the plane and replace said tire, then give all the watching passengers the thumbs up with a big smile.

Had a really rough landing approch in a storm where pasengers were screaming, I'll readily admit it was scary at the time.

And once coming into land at a regional in heavy fog I saw the tree tops right there at the wing level, then in an instant heard the engines power up, we entered a steep climb and the gear came up, pilot then spoke on the intercom and explained they were doing a go around for another attempt which they nailed just fine.

I've found the Carenado Saab 340 an enjoyable plane to fly and easy to get started in. It also installs as a normal and lite version, though I'm not sure what the lite version entails .

It has a pretty good model including a cabin where the cockpit door can be opened and you can see through both ways.

Also includes support for the F1/RPX GTN which I've installed (a little exe does the install).

Here we are on flights from Narrabri YNBR to Inverell YIVL
